The young generation of Cubans living in St. Vincent and the Grenadines was present at the Embassy of Cuba to participate in the celebration of culture day, with their own contribution of talent and patriotism.
With their virtuoso performances of the Bayamo Hymn and other Cuban melodies on Steel Pan, the children Mathew Ernesto Ralph Israel and Michel Enrique Israel, made a substantive contribution to the celebration of Cuban National Culture Day.
Meanwhile, from the front row, attentive to what happened, the youngest ones followed the recounts and images of historical passages, the speeches about the importance and meaning of the day of culture for each Cuban, the declarations of support for the revolution, to the new project of Constitution and the rejection of the economic, commercial and financial blockade of the USA against Cuba, as well as the performances of the cultural program.
Later, together with their parents, the children enjoyed the exhibition of Cuban painters, organized by the Embassy for such a special occasion.
